Here is what we will consider when designing your packaging:

Product Dimensions: Understand the size, shape, and weight of the item being packaged. The packaging should be appropriately sized to snugly fit the product without excessive movement.

Fragility: Assess the fragility of the item. Delicate or fragile items may require thicker and more cushioned foam to absorb shocks and vibrations during handling and transportation.

Impact Resistance: Consider the potential impact forces the package may encounter during transit. Is your product being shipped by air, sea, or land? Choose foam materials and designs that provide adequate shock absorption to protect the product from damage.

Environmental Conditions: Determine the environmental conditions the package will be exposed to, such as temperature extremes or moisture. Select foam materials that can withstand these conditions without degradation.

Packaging Labor Time: How long will it take your employee to package your products.

Storage Space: Do you have limited space? Again, this is another reason we look to use the most efficient packaging from both a material usage standpoint and a storage standpoint.

Cost-effectiveness: Balance the need for protective packaging with cost considerations. Optimize the design to minimize material usage while still providing sufficient protection.

Appearance: Your packaging should look professional, fit your product and enhance its perceived value.

Foams that we use include Expanded Polystyrene (EPS) Foam, commonly called Styrofoam, Polyethylene (PE) Foam), Polyurethane (PU) Foam, Cross-Linked (XLPE) Foam, Expanded Polyethylene (EPE) Foam, Polyester (Ester) Foam, Convoluted (Eggcrate) Foam, Ethylene-Vinyl Acetate (EVA) Foam, High Resilient (HR) Foam, Polyethylene Terephthalate (PET) Foams, open cell foam, closed cell foam, low density foam, high density foam, rigid foam, flexible foam, thermal insulating foam, recycled foam, moisture resistant foam, ESD anti-static foam and more. We can combine foam with different materials including corrugated, coroplast, rigid with flexible foams, etc.
